The recipe is so simple


Dry oatmeal
Almond milk
Frozen mixed berries
Pure Canadian Maple Syrup 
Almond slivers, raisins, Chia Seeds etc. (optional)


Before bed grab your ingredients and a container
Place 1/2 cup dry oats into bottom
Cover with almond milk (keep pouring until it soaks in and covers it)
Top with 1/2 cup or more of still frozen berry mix
cover and place in fridge



Go to bed


Wake up
Drizzle your 
"Cold Vegan Overnight Oatmeal"
with pure Canadian Maple Syrup


Top with a few spoonfuls of various toppings of your choice
Chia seeds etc.


Enjoy!

The Oatmeal Project: Cherry Almond Date Night Recipe


Recently I enjoyed a generous bowl of oatmeal
at a castle wedding.


I couldn't stop thinking about it.



I decided to purchase a 2.5 Qt. Crock Pot

(All research suggested best results achieved with a small 2.5 crock pot)


This was my first bowl of goodness
this morning.


So good for you
and a crowd-pleaser.


Here is my humble recipe:

1 cup Steel Cut Oats
1 cup Regular Oats
2 tbsp. Flax Seeds
2 tbsp. dried cherries
2 tbsp. raisins
2 tbsp. sunflower seeds
2 tbsp. slivered almonds
4 pitted dates rough chopped small
3.5 cups water

At 10 pm or so
coat your crock pot with thin layer oil or spray
to prevent sticking
set on 'low'

Add all the ingredients
then mix in the water

stir well

close lid
Go to Bed

Wake up 
6 am
Enjoy a bowl of dreamy oatmeal
top with a tbsp of almonds
or topping of choice
